Thousands expected at memorial service Sunday

Thousands of people are expected to attend a community gathering Sunday in Santa Barbara to remember those who died in the mudslide at La Conchita and in the tsunami disaster in South Asia.

Lucy Popova, spokeswoman with the American Red Cross, said residents of La Conchita are encouraged to attend the gathering, which will be at 2 p.m. at Santa Barbara City College La Playa Stadium on Shoreline Drive.

Donations will be accepted and people can make contributions to the American Red Cross or Direct Relief International.

People are being encouraged to wear red and white clothing because organizers plan to ask those who attend to form a huge heart.
